Patrimonial administration: (a) personal agents of monarch (b) rooted in royal household. Bureaucratic administration why? (a) more demanding and dangerous warfare (b) more complex economy and society (c) democratic pressures. Weber was a good student of china and india and the extensive empire bureaucracy. Offices with assigned responsibilities that have people with assigned tasks. There is a formal hierarchy within the workplace. 20th century massive growth in: (a) area"s of state activity (ex. Late 20th century/early 21st century new public management (a) contracting out: the idea that we want to encourage different services to be provided by the private sector for a smaller cost (b) quangos (c) performance incentives. How most people believe a decision should be made. Decisions made through small adjustments dictated by changing circumstances. Bureaucratic organization models: pays attention to impact that policy making process has on resulting decisions (a) no unified state different agency perspectives (b) short-termism, satisficing".
